    Park City, Utah, is a world away from the ordinary, offering a lifestyle that effortlessly blends outdoor adventure with small-town charm. Imagine strolling along streets with a Walk Score of 71, far exceeding the national average, where you're just steps away from world-class dining, unique boutiques, and, of course, the legendary ski slopes. While the median home value here is a significant $1,150,000, the high median household income of $95,760 and a low unemployment rate of 2.5% suggest a community that thrives on both work and play. The affordability index of 48 reflects the premium placed on this exceptional quality of life.

    From an investment perspective, Park City presents a compelling opportunity. The high homeownership rate of 68.0% underscores a commitment to the area, and the median rent of $1,830 offers a glimpse into the rental market dynamics. Crime rates are remarkably low, with a violent crime rate of 2.3 per 1,000 residents and a property crime rate of 29.6 per 1,000 residents, ensuring peace of mind. This is a place for those who value both luxury and security, seeking a community where the mountains meet the modern.

    Beyond the real estate, Park City boasts an exceptional environment. The air quality is rated at a remarkable AQI of 3, ensuring clean mountain air, and the noise level is considered quiet. Residents enjoy an electricity rate of 10.3¢/kWh, and the area's climate offers four distinct seasons, perfect for year-round recreation. Known for its world-class skiing, snowboarding, and film festivals, Park City provides a stunning backdrop for creating lasting memories, making it a truly unique place to call home.

    Park, Utah at a Glance

    Park is a city in Park City, Utah with a population of approximately 8,467. The median home value is $1,150,000 and the median household income is $95,760. It has a Walk Score of 71 out of 100, making it very walkable. The violent crime rate is 1.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 50% below the national average. Air quality is rated Good. The overall climate risk is rated as "Relatively Low." Median rent is $1,830 per month. Data sourced from the US Census Bureau, FBI Crime Data Explorer, EPA, Walk Score, and FEMA.

    Local Events & Festivals

    Sundance Film Festival

    A major independent film festival held annually in January.

    Park City Kimball Arts Festival

    A summer arts festival featuring artists from around the country.

    Deer Valley Music Festival

    A summer classical and popular music festival.

    Park City Wine & Food Festival

    A festival featuring wine and culinary experiences.
